Tetraaryl-methane analogues in group 14—V. Distortion of tetrahedral geometryin terms of through-space π–π and π–σ interactions andNMR sagging in ter…

1998

Abstract 44 members of thecompound series Ph4−nMRn (M=Si, Ge, Sn, Pb; R=o-, m-, p-Tol; n=0–4) were synthesized (15 newcompounds). The crystal structures of Ph3Sn (o-Tol) and PhSn (o-Tol)3 were determined and compared to 16 known structures. Subject to the distanced (M–C), an interplay between through-space π–π repulsion and π–σ attraction leads to either elongated or compressed tetrahedral geometry. 29 Si-, 119 Sn- and 207 Pb-NMR chemical shifts were determined in solution and in the solid state.73 Ge chemical shifts were measured only in solution.
